PGA Championship odds have Scottie Scheffler and Rory McIlroy as favorites at Valhalla
The PGA Championship is back at Valhalla Golf Club for the first time since 2014.
Set for Thursday through Sunday, the 2024 PGA Championship has a total purse of $17,500,000. The latest odds have Scottie Scheffler as a heavy favorite to claim the $3,150,000 winning purse.
Rory McIlroy is a close second and is coming into the tournament hot after winning the Wells Fargo Championship on May 12.
